About

A salary is not what an employee costs. On top of gross pay, a US employer owes Social
Security and Medicare (FICA), federal unemployment (FUTA), state unemployment (SUI), any
state-specific employer taxes, and workers' compensation.

EmployerCosts adds a small badge next to every salary on job listings showing the
fully-burdened annual cost to employ that role — and the burden as a percentage over
salary. Click the badge for an itemized breakdown (every tax line, the total, and the
fully-burdened hourly rate).

Works on: Indeed, LinkedIn, Glassdoor, ZipRecruiter.

Features
1. Fully-burdened employer cost next to each salary — no clicks, no copy-paste.
2. State-accurate: 2026 SUI wage bases + new-employer rates and state-specific employer
taxes for all 50 states + DC, auto-detected from each listing's location.
3. Handles hourly ↔ annual and salary ranges (uses the midpoint).
4. Click for the itemized breakdown (Social Security, Medicare, FUTA, SUI, state-specific,
workers' comp).
5. Employer-paid statutory costs only by default; employee withholdings are excluded.
Optional benefits load and a fixed "my state" mode in the popup.
